Manchester United captain: “The club wanted to sell me. They lacked courage”

Bruno Fernandes is unhappy with the club”, — write: sport.ua

The leading midfielder and captain of Manchester United Bruno Fernandes said that in the summer the club wanted to make money by selling him to one of the Saudi Arabian teams, but the management failed to do so.

“I refused to go to a club in Saudi Arabia. Not only because of my family, but also because I really like playing for Manchester United. I got the feeling from the management that “it would be good if you left.” It offended and saddened me.”

“I never refused to play for Manchester United, I give all my strength in matches. They wanted me to leave, but they didn’t have the courage to push through the transfer because the coach was against it.”

“Ruben Amorim wants me to play here,” Fernandes said.

This season, the player scored 5 goals and made 7 assists.
